Output e255105165d8ee784fd7336300e711e8ed17dfee58cbfd631a8afddad9fd4347:61

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e28bfc05dcf89de0dc58e7d610740c719c516f6bef6b1792821b63b3ae1cf87
address
bc1p3c5tlszae7yaurw93e7kzp6qcuvu29hkhmmtz7fgyxmrkwhpe7rsvnp2nv
transaction
e255105165d8ee784fd7336300e711e8ed17dfee58cbfd631a8afddad9fd4347
spent
true